If you're a beneficiary of the Department of Work and Pensions, your payment dates might alter during the holiday season. This year, Christmas Day lands on a Wednesday and Boxing Day on a Thursday, both bank holidays, as is New Year's Day on January 1.
This could lead to some adjustments in when your benefits will be disbursed. HMRC has confirmed changes to Tax Credits.Payments due on Wednesday, December 25 will be paid on Tuesday, December 24 Payments due on Thursday, December 26 will be paid on Tuesday, December 24 Payments due on Friday, December 27 will be paid on Tuesday, December 24 Payments due on Wednesday, January 1 will be paid on Tuesday, December 31 Payments due on December 25, 26 and 27 will be paid on Tuesday, December 24.
The Department for Work and Pensions has not yet published its December payments schedule but it's anticipated to follow a similar pattern to that set by HMRC. This would imply that benefits usually received on the 25th, 26th or 27th of the month will instead be credited to people's accounts on December 24, reports Bristol Live.Payments expected on January 1 could arrive on New Year's Eve.
